Microchip Technology MCP3913 Evaluation Board (ADM00522)

Microchip Technology MCP3913 Evaluation Board (ADM00522) is a demonstration and development platform for the MCP3913 6-Channel Analog Front End (AFE). The MCP3913 combines six simultaneous sampling delta-sigma (ΔΣ) Analog-to-Digital Converters (ADC) and six Programmable Gain Amplifiers (PGA) in a single device. The MCP3913 also integrates a phase delay compensation block, a low-drift internal voltage reference, digital offset and gain error calibration registers, and a high-speed 20MHz SPI compatible serial interface. 

The Microchip Technology MCP3913 Evaluation Board also provides a development platform for 16-bit PIC® microcontroller-based applications. The system comes with a programmed PIC24FJ256GA110 Plug-in Module (PIM) that communicates with the Hi-Resolution ADC Utility software for data exchange and ADC setup via a USB connection to the board.

Features

  • Six-channel ADC MCP3913 output display using serial communication to the PC software interface
  • Simultaneous 57ksps at OSR32 address loop ALL or 95dB SINAD at OSR512 performance on MCP3913
  • System and ADC performance analysis through graphical PC software showing noise histogram, frequency domain (FFT), time domain scope plot, and statistical numerical analysis
  • Robust hardware design with analog grounding and analog/digital separation, allowing low noise evaluation of the MCP3913 device; includes separate power supplies and power planes on a 4-layer board 
  • PICtail™ Plus connectors for Explorer 16 daughter board compatibility
